The typical American commute has been getting longer each year since 2010. The average one-way commute in Chireno takes 20.4 minutes. That's shorter than the US average of 26.4 minutes.

How people in Chireno get to work:
- 64.8% drive their own car alone
- 28.7% carpool with others
- 0.0% work from home
- 0.0% take mass transit
